Kathy Drinkard: How the VCHR is Preventing Israel Affinity Organizations from Politicizing K-12 Textbooks.

Kathy Drinkard is a retired teacher and elementary school counselor. She has long been concerned about the suffering in the Palestinian territories and has been involved with her church on the issue for more than a decade. She has traveled to the region four times, most recently in the fall of 2018, a trip she helped plan. During her second trip, she spent 10 days in Nablus visiting an Anglican congregation that is in partnership with her church. Her third trip was to participate in a seminar, “Faith in the Face of Empire,” sponsored by the Reverend Dr. Mitri Raheb and Bright Stars of Bethlehem.

She currently is chair of the Ministry for Middle East Peace and Justice at Grace Presbyterian Church in Springfield, VA.
